Examples of Election Impact on Peace Initiatives
In recent decades, voting outcomes have significantly impacted international relations, influencing the path of peace initiatives across diverse parts of the world. A notable case is the 2016 United States vote, where the victory of a candidate with nontraditional views on global affairs altered longstanding commitments to international partnerships and agreements. This shift reshaped U.S. participation in conflict resolution, particularly in the region of the Middle East and North Korea, leading to a re-evaluation of diplomatic strategies that had been in function for decades.
Another exemplary instance comes from Colombian politics, where the 2018 presidential election brought a transition in government, which saw a firm critic of the peace agreement with the FARC rebels taking power. This change in leadership raised questions about the stability of the negotiation and the future of conversations aimed at resolving the nation’s long-standing issues with violence and injustice. The new administration’s strategy highlighted the ways in which electoral decisions can either bolster or undermine decades of efforts to achieve lasting peace.
Lastly, the recent elections in Israel showcased how a change in government can impact diplomacy in the Middle East. With the rise of a government advocating a significantly hardline stance towards Palestinian authorities, hopes for a revival of diplomatic discussions waned. The electoral results emphasized how domestic political shifts can extend beyond borders, influencing global views and the feasibility of international diplomacy in a part of the world long filled with strife. Each of these instances exemplifies the intricate relationship between electoral outcomes and the prospects for peace on a global scale.
